Rishi Kapoor, Padmini Kolhapure Fly Together 'After Years'

Darpan News Desk IANS, 21 Jul, 2015 01:05 PM
    Veteran actor Rishi Kapoor was seen with yesteryear actress Padmini Kolhapure while travelling back from Hyderabad.
     
    The 62-year-old took to Twitter, where he shared a selfie along with Padmini on Monday night. Rishi was seen sporting an orange t-shirt, while the actress donned a bright yellow top.
     
    "Flying with the Padmini Kolhapure from Hydrabad. After years!," Rishi captioned the image. 
     
    The duo has been seen in movies like "Prem Rog", "Yeh Ishq Nahin Aasaan", "Hawalaat", "Pyar Ke Kabil" and "Zamane Ko Dikhana Hai".
